Double parked

This week I was using the XJS as my daily driver and so I drove it a couple of days to my work. In the parking garage there are on the first floor two spots on both ends which have a small concrete wall and only place to park two small cars. Often these spots are taken by large cars and as such taking up two places. So this time around I used the opportunity to park my car on that spot, mostly to avoid any parking damage by other car doors. I have to admit I parked it slightly diagonal but the result would have been in any case that I was using up two parking spots. I also hoped that a classic car would be excused to take up these two spots. But apparently someone disagreed with me. I suspect it must have been this motorcycle rider who managed to squeeze in his bike. It had a Dutch license plate though but judging on the written message I sense it must have been a native English person.
